The Eastern Chipmunk ( Tamias striatus) is a member of the squirrel family in the order Rodentia. It's believed that the English word "chipmunk" was derived from "chetamnon," the name given to the animal by peoples of the Chippewa nation. Eastern Chipmunks are found in the United States east of the Great Plains, north to Maine, and ...

Redbelly snakes … fischer\u0027s bee-quickWebGround squirrels are easily seen on warm, sunny days. Look for grooves in the grass where they travel between holes. Den entrance is 2-3 inches wide and 3-4 inches long. They prefer sandy, dry soil. Populations can get quite high, >30 per acre.
